/// Most basic trait of a netlist.
///
/// ## Netlist component relations
///
/// A netlist consists of circuits which are templates for circuit instances.
/// Each circuit may contain such instances of other circuits.
///
/// The following diagram illustrates how this composition graph can be traversed using the functions
/// defined by `NetlistBase`.
///
/// ```txt
///                          each_circuit_dependency
///                      +---------------------------+
///                      |                           |
///                      +                           v
///       +----------------+ each_dependent_circuit +------------------+
///       |Circuit (Top)   |<----------------------+|Circuit (Sub)     |
///       +----------------+                        +------------------+
///       |+              ^|                        | ^   +            |
///       ||each_instance ||                        | |   |            |
///       ||              ||                        | |   |            |
///       ||              |parent_circuit           | |   |            |
///       ||              ||                        | |   |            |
///       ||+-----------+ ||                        | |   |            |
///  +--> |>|Inst1 (Sub)|-+|                        | |   |            |
///  |    ||+-----------+  |                        | |   |            |
///  |    ||               |                        | |   |            |
///  |    ||               |                        +-|---|------------+
///  |    ||               |                          |   |
///  |    ||+-----------+  |  template_circuit        |   |
///  +--> |>|Inst2 (Sub)|+----------------------------+   |
///  |    | +-----------+  |                              |
///  |    |                |                              |
///  |    |                |                              |
///  |    +----------------+                              |
///  |                                                    |
///  |                         each_reference             |
///  +----------------------------------------------------+
/// ```
///
